Pedestrian killed trying to cross four lanes of traffic in Perth

A tragic accident claimed the life of a 31-year-old man in Perth’s southern region when he was struck by a vehicle while attempting to traverse four lanes of traffic.

According to stunned onlookers, the incident occurred around 9:15 p.m. on Rockingham Road in Hamilton Hill. The man was accompanied by his dog at the time of the accident.

As a result of the collision, authorities blocked off all four lanes of traffic, marking a somber scene as investigations unfolded.

Witness Harvey recounted the harrowing moment, saying, “I actually saw the person who was running across the road flying up into the air. That image is quite traumatising, you know. It sticks in your brain.”

The man was hit by a southbound silver Toyota Corolla during his attempt to cross the busy road.

The driver and others, including an off-duty nurse and several medical students, stopped to help.

“He did a sprint, across the road at the wrong moment. He probably thought he could make it,” Harvey said.

The man was taken to Fiona Stanley Hospital where he later died.

Major crash detectives closed the road for several hours.

Residents say the stretch of Rockingham Road is notorious, leaving some too scared to turn out of their driveways, because trying to get across four lanes of traffic is too dangerous.

It’s not the first time an accident has happened here.

“This corner has had a lot of accidents here, our house has been hit before, and our neighbour had someone actually go through the front of her house,” resident Marnie said.

The 32-year-old was assisting police but no charges had been laid.
